2008 Photo Gallery Updates: The Dark Knight, Cloverfield, Speed Racer, and More!
The year we make contact with Uwe Boll.
by Alex Vo | December 11, 2007
Discuss Article
Most of the critics associations have spoken, the Golden Globes will announce their nominees in two days, and another year draws to a close. But enough about 2007. We're eagerly wondering, "Will 2008 be as much fun?" Though the magic and wizardry of the electronic press kit, let us journey into the future and peek at what the major studios are up to for the upcoming months.

We know now grimy digital cameras and monsters from the Atlantic can make for compelling trailer cinema, but will that be enough to sustain a feature-length movie? We'll find out January 18 when Paramount unleashes Cloverfield.

They've got the munchies...for adventure! BFFs Harold and Kumar return April 25 for another dazed and confused romp in Harold and Kumar Escape from Guantanamo Bay, this time getting sidetracked during a totally innocent trip to Amsterdam.

The first trailer and handful of Speed Racer production stills are out, and fanboy reaction so far has been passionately divided. Exactly how the mischievous Wachowskis would like it, we're sure. Speed Racer will hit the multiplex circuit on May 9.

Sometimes the Batmobile (especially Batman Begins' armored Frankenstein-on-wheels) just can't weave through Gotham City traffic fast enough. That's when you call up the Batpod. It'll probably get some nifty chase scenes in The Dark Knight, in theaters July 18.

America's busiest A-list director, Ridley Scott, makes his 2008 mark with, um, Untitled Ridley Scott Thriller. Already widely known by its production title, Body of Lies, the film will star Leonardo DiCaprio, Russell Crowe, and Carice von Houten.

Of course, let's not forget that wonderful medium almost as old as cinema itself: the movie poster! Our personal picks for the best 2008 posters so far:

   

These posters are for Funny Games (Feb. 15), One Missed Call (Jan. 4), and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ull (May 22).
